After travelling to Jamaica a number of times this experience was my most memorable. I love Jamaica and its people, and it is a vast and amazingly beautiful place. Admittedly if you’re travelling around the island you have to be cautious, but that is where I can help you to go to the right places and see the island safely.

This particular trip took me to 2 completely different accommodations on the Island, the first hotel in Negril called Ten Sing Pen, it really is a very special place situated on a rocky out crop along from some fabulous beaches, Ten Sing Pen is a place unlike any other I have stayed in. It is a small group of cottages built on and into the rock face with direct access to the sea, great for people who like simplicity and quietness. The staff are wonderful and the accommodations bring you back to the basics, but beautifully decorated using locally made furnishings. The food is served in a restaurant where you can see the kitchen and real home cooked Jamaican food, it really is an escape into paradise and very romantic!

The second part of holiday was spent in the Tryall Club in Montego Bay, a fabulous resort made up of privately owned villas set around an 18 hole world championship golf course. Not being a golfer myself this did not matter, although I did take a few lessons with the onsite golfing school, great fun and I could even hit the ball by the end of the holiday! There is a fabulous beach marina area that will give you the chance to do some water sports. You go around the resort on a golf cart which comes as part of your villa! The restaurants are exquisite! One in the great house and one at the beachside serve excellent Jamaican dishes and you mustn't miss the weekly barbecue, great fun with great entertainment. You will never feel like you are surrounded by too many people as the resort is so spacious.
